Not sure if someone's already posted this.
Can use WinSCP, Terminal or Mobile Terminal
1. SSH to iPhone 2. Goto /System/Library/TextInput 3. Rename TextInput_en.bundle to whatever you like
By using Mobile Terminal 1. enter "su" and password to go to root account 2. "cd /System/Library/TextInput" 3. "mv TextInput_en.bundle TextInput_en_bk.bundle"
DONE.

Prophet. writes...
How does one SSH to the iPhone...
I can't even tell what it's IP is...
You need to jailbreak the phone and install the SSHd.
The IP address is listed under the WiFi connection you have established, press the blue > button for it under Settings > Wi-Fi.
